Understanding Bifold Doors
Bifold doors are made up of several panels that fold upon themselves, enabling them to open totally to one side. They can be made from numerous products, consisting of wood, aluminum, and PVC. When selecting bifold doors, you ought to consider:

When you've picked a bifold door installer, understanding the installation process will help you get ready for the job. Here's a summary:
Step 1: Consultation and Measurement
The installer will assess your area and take exact measurements to guarantee the bifold doors fit completely.
Action 2: Selecting the Right Doors
You will discuss your preferences concerning materials, colors, and designs. The installer can provide suggestions based on existing market trends.
Step 3: Preparing the Opening
The installer will prepare the existing entrance by making any needed adjustments. This action may involve getting rid of old doors, repairing the frame, or adjusting the floor level.
Step 4: Installation of the Bifold Doors
During this stage, the installer will secure the door frame, enabling it to fit seamlessly into your space. They will make sure that all panels operate smoothly and are properly lined up.
Step 5: Final Adjustments and Cleanup
As soon as installed, the professional will make final adjustments and clean the work area. A comprehensive inspection will ensure the bifold doors function as meant.
Maintenance Tips for Bifold Doors
Proper upkeep is essential to lengthening the lifespan of bifold doors and ensuring they run efficiently. Here's a fast list:
Regular Cleaning: Clean the glass panels and frames frequently utilizing non-abrasive cleaners.Lubrication: Apply lubricant to the tracks and hinges at least once a year to help with smooth operation.Examine Seals: Check the weather condition seals for any wear or damage, replacing them as necessary to preserve energy effectiveness.Keep Tracks Clear: Regularly eliminate any debris from the tracks to prevent obstructions.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does it require to set up bifold doors?
The installation normally takes one to two days, depending on the intricacy of the task and the variety of panels being set up.
2. Are bifold doors energy effective?
Yes, modern-day Bifold Patio Doors doors can be extremely energy-efficient, especially those with double or triple glazing. They help maintain indoor temperatures and decrease energy bills.
